What used to happen
The old flow worked, technically. You subscribed, got an email inviting you to set a password, logged into the app, and only then could you read a gated post. It made sense on paper - a real account meant I could track who had access. In practice, it was a wall between βI clicked a link in an emailβ and βI am reading the thing I wanted to read,β and most people quite reasonably did not climb it.
What changes today
Every gated-post link in your newsletter now carries a personal key, invisible in the text you read, baked into the link itself. Click it, and the article opens - already unlocked. No login screen, no password to invent and immediately forget.
Why did I build a second gate around simply reading an article? Because βprove who you areβ and βread this textβ are different problems, and I had been solving the easy one (reading) with the tool built for the hard one (an account system). A personal link solves reading directly.
